New Diterpenes from the South African Soft Coral Eleutherobia aurea

Abstract
The known diterpenoids zahavin A and 9-deacetoxy-14,15-deepoxyxeniculin and the two new diterpenoids 7,8-epoxyzahavin A and xeniolide C were isolated from specimens of Eleutherobia aurea collected from Aliwal Shoal off the southern Kwazulu-Natal coast, South Africa. Standard spectroscopic methods were used for the structure determinations. The former three diterpenoids inhibit superoxide production in rabbit-cell neutrophils.
